The interest code "SEI" is often associated with this major, however, the SuperStrong assessment can help you understand how your interests connect to a variety of majors and career options. Students who take the SuperStrong Interest Inventory receive a three-letter interest code, which identifies their top three areas of interest, work activities, potential skills, and personal values. These skills include strong verbal and written communication skills, deep understanding of the institutions and processes that shape the world, cross-cultural knowledge, and understanding, and listening, clarifying, questioning, and responding skills. Some analyze the workings of global institutions and explore the operations of the global health, food, and financial systems. Global studies courses traverse geography and time. In short, global studies is a major for students who are committed both to understanding the world and to making it a better place. When you examine migration, you’ll better understand immigration laws and the analyses of human mobility trends as well as the geopolitical upheavals and food systems failures that drive these trends.Īnd you’ll always keep in view the grassroots and community initiatives that address these problems on the ground since that is where people feel the impacts of problems most powerfully and where they work out creative solutions. For example, you’ll learn to think of climate change not only in terms of carbon dioxide levels in the atmosphere, but also in terms of politics, ecologies, social movements, and global inequalities. Global studies students cultivate broad perspectives on the contemporary world. ![]()
